I cannot seem to define which is the official version that is read from when reading the epistles, etc at the DL in the Byzantine Catholic Church (Ruthenian). Can anyone help?

The Ruthenians use a lectionary Gospel and Apostol based on the NAB, though just which version of the NAB I can't tell you. Melkites, on the other hand, seem to use whatever version the celebrant or reader prefers, or which happens to by laying around--though none that I have noticed seem to favor the NAB. The Byantine Seminary Press Gospel and Epistle books use the original 1970 NAB. The Alleluia Press Gospel and Epistle books use the Confraternity Version, as did the book of readings arranged by Fr. Grigassy of which a few copies are still floating around. I suspect these would be the most commonly encountered translations. Orthodox use the KJV, NKJV, and RSV.
